If your question is addressing weight management, then the best way to lose weight and keep it off is to spend mental and physical energy, day in and day out, eating healthy calorie-controlled meals and getting in that calorie-burning exercise. In short, balancing the calorie math. The goal for weight loss is to consume fewer calories than your body requires, creating what is termed a &ldquo;calorie deficit.&rdquo; A calorie deficit of 500 calories per day results in a one-pound weight loss of body fat in one week&rsquo;s time.</p><p>Whichever time of day you get in a major &ldquo;bout&rdquo; of calorie-burning activity is up to your personal schedule. Ideally, you&rsquo;ll want to get in a planned exercise bout in addition to being physically active throughout the day, such as parking farther away from the store and taking the stairs instead of the elevator.</p><p>In summary, the time of day you eat or exercise does not impact calorie burning. Your best bet is to eat small, frequent, nutritious (calorie-controlled) meals throughout the day and combine that eating style with a daily exercise bout as well as making an effort to simply move around more. That is what is important for your personal calorie balance and the secret to lifelong weight control.</p><p>By Dr. Janet Bond Brill</p> Fri, 10 Sep 2010 00:00:00 -0500 http://fitnesstogether.com/ashland/blog/2062/Fitness-QA-What-is-the-best-time-to-workout-for-maximum-calorie-burn Press Release: Personal Training Studio in Ashland and Southborough, MA Unveils Proprietary Nutrition Program http://fitnesstogether.com/ashland/blog/1264/Press-Release-Personal-Training-Studio-in-Ashland-and-Southborough-MA-Unveils-Proprietary-Nutrition-Program- <p><strong>F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E&nbsp; </strong></p><p>For more information contact:&nbsp;</p><p>Bob Savin, Owner, ACSM Certified Personal Trainer&nbsp;</p><p>Phone: 508-438-0050&nbsp;</p><p>Email: <a href="mailto:BobSavin@fitnesstogether.com">BobSavin@fitnesstogether.com</a>&nbsp;</p><p><strong>Personal Training Studio in Ashland and Southborough, MA Unveils Proprietary Nutrition Program&nbsp; </strong></p><p>Ashland, MA. &ndash; 6/1/2010 &ndash; Fitness Together in Ashland and Southborough, MA is stepping up services for clients, by launching<em> </em>a <a href="http://corp.fitnesstogether.com/" target="_blank">proprietary nutrition program</a>. &nbsp;Modeled after the same one-on-one approach used for Fitness Together&rsquo;s personal training, Nutrition Together provides clients nutrition guidance in tandem with fitness training to help achieve and maintain a healthy lifestyle.&nbsp;</p><p>With the motto &ldquo;Eat healthy. It is a fairly new product that can consist of virtually anything, but generally comprises a mixture of 100% whole grain and white flour. The white wheat comes from an albino variety of wheat that differs from the traditional red wheat kernels. Furthermore, the white wheat is more heavily processed than the 100% whole grain flour to make the product taste more like its refined cousins, though the jury is still out regarding exactly how much nutrition is lost in the processing.<br /><br />The product is marketed to regular consumers of white bread who want to consume more whole grains for the health benefits but just can&rsquo;t quite take the plunge to eating 100% whole grain products. So, for those people, the new &ldquo;white wheat&rdquo; products are a better choice than refined white bread products. The bottom line is, nutrition-wise, your best bet is to routinely go for the 100% whole wheat products that have been less processed, contain all three parts of the original wheat kernel and have been shown scientifically to help prevent chronic disease.</p> Fri, 21 May 2010 00:00:00 -0500 http://fitnesstogether.com/ashland/blog/1021/Fitness-QA-When-it-comes-to-choosing-a-healthy-bread-is-whole-grain-white-any-different-from-regular-whole-wheat-bread Fitness Q&A: Is there really any nutritional value in lettuce? http://fitnesstogether.com/ashland/blog/950/Fitness-QA-Is-there-really-any-nutritional-value-in-lettuce <p>Answer:&nbsp; Lettuce is a leafy crunchy vegetable with substantial water content, some fiber and a negligible calorie count&mdash;all factors that are beneficial for filling up your plate and pairing down your waistline.&nbsp;<br /><br />You should know that only certain types of lettuce are loaded with lots of vitamins, minerals and antioxidant plant chemicals, whereas others contain virtually nothing in terms of nutrition. Hence, even though all types of lettuce are low in calories, the different varieties offer different valuable sources of nutrients. For example, romaine lettuce is especially rich in vitamins A, C, and K, folate, and manganese when compared to iceberg lettuce.&nbsp;<br /><br />When making lettuce choices, be sure to get in the power lettuces, romaine and red leaf&mdash;the darker the leaf, the greater the amount of nutrients such as vitamin A and folate. Other salad greens, such as spinach, kale, arugula and radicchio, while technically not lettuces, are among the most nutrient-dense foods available.&nbsp;<br /><br />So when it comes to good health and weight control, be sure to pile on the dark leafy greens (an antioxidant gold mine), and leave the iceberg in the bin!</p><p><em>Posted by <a href="http://www.drjanet.com/about.html" target="_blank">Dr. Janet Bond Brill</a></em></p> Fri, 14 May 2010 00:00:00 -0500 http://fitnesstogether.com/ashland/blog/950/Fitness-QA-Is-there-really-any-nutritional-value-in-lettuce Fitness Q&A: What is a good rule to follow when selecting healthy foods? http://fitnesstogether.com/ashland/blog/908/Fitness-QA-What-is-a-good-rule-to-follow-when-selecting-healthy-foods <p>Answer:&nbsp; The fewer the ingredients, the better!&nbsp;&nbsp;When it comes to making wise nutrition choices, the golden rule on the ingredient list is &ldquo;less is better!&rdquo; This is because the most nutritious foods are generally the least processed foods with the least amount of additives. The closer the food is to the way Mother Nature intended it to be, the more natural vitamins, minerals, fiber and phytonutrients the food product will contain.&nbsp;</p><div><p>For example, it&rsquo;s always healthier to choose an apple over a slice of apple pie loaded with unhealthy fats, salt, spoilage retardants, refined carbohydrates and excess calories. If you peruse the frozen vegetable case, better to grab the bag of frozen peas that simply contains two ingredients&mdash;peas and salt&mdash;rather than a frozen pea product with 20 ingredients in the list. Another important tip regarding processed foods is that if you have a choice, make the food yourself (such as your own tomato sauce versus a jar of sauce). This way YOU control the ingredients and can be very judicious with adding in excess amounts of harmful ingredients such as sodium and bad fats.</p></div> Mon, 10 May 2010 00:00:00 -0500 http://fitnesstogether.com/ashland/blog/908/Fitness-QA-What-is-a-good-rule-to-follow-when-selecting-healthy-foods Need Help with Childcare? http://fitnesstogether.com/ashland/blog/896/Need-Help-with-Childcare <p>Fitness Together clients can now take advantage of a special arrangement for child care.<br />&nbsp;<br />Just-A-Wee Day Child Care center is located in the same plaza as our FT Ashland studio.&nbsp; They are a licensed child care center offering programs for infants, toddlers, preschool and school-age children (up to 9 years).&nbsp; The facility offers separate areas where age-appropriate activities are conducted and they pay careful attention to teacher/student ratios.</p><p>We have arranged for a special, 90-minute child care session that will compliment your 45-minute workout session.&nbsp; There is no up-front financial commitment (child care sessions are paid at drop-off) and you do not need to commit to any weekly schedule.<br />&nbsp; <br />If you have questions, you can contact Just-A-Wee-Day Child Care Directly by calling 508-881-6077 or you can ask your trainer to review their literature the next time you visit our Ashland studio.</p> Thu, 06 May 2010 00:00:00 -0500 http://fitnesstogether.com/ashland/blog/896/Need-Help-with-Childcare Custom Personal Training Programs for Kids and Teens http://fitnesstogether.com/ashland/blog/899/Custom-Personal-Training-Programs-for-Kids-and-Teens <p>Our private personal training is perfect for children age 12* to 17 who need to lose weight for medical reasons, have other health concerns, or just want to work one-on-one to accomplish <br />their goals with fewer distractions.&nbsp;</p><p>The sessions are 45-minutes in length and are conducted in one of our private training suites with a certified FT personal trainer.&nbsp;&nbsp;We will start out with a free consultation which will give us the opportunity&nbsp;to discuss your&nbsp;child's goals and any health history that may affect his or her exercise routine.&nbsp; Then we will take him or her through some exercises.&nbsp;</p><p>*Exceptions may be made for children younger than twelve years of age who are mature and have a strong desire to work with a trainer.</p> Thu, 06 May 2010 00:00:00 -0500 http://fitnesstogether.com/ashland/blog/899/Custom-Personal-Training-Programs-for-Kids-and-Teens Sports Conditioning for Teens http://fitnesstogether.com/ashland/blog/900/Sports-Conditioning-for-Teens <p>The off-season is the perfect time to focus on getting stronger and improving overall physical conditioning.&nbsp; Since all of our programs are custom, we can assist athletes from any sport to improve their performance and reduce the chance for injury during the season.</p><p>The goal of our teen sport conditioning program is to increase the strength of all major muscle groups as well as specific muscle groups that are closely associated with your child&rsquo;s sport(s) while placing a heavy emphasis on safety and proper use of equipment.&nbsp; We will also provide your child with a polar heart rate monitor and show him or her how to use the monitor to maximize cardiovascular workouts.&nbsp; General instruction and coaching on cardiovascular conditioning will also be a part of your child&rsquo;s program.</p><p>Over the course of your child&rsquo;s training, he or she will receive age appropriate coaching in areas such as basic nutrition principles, general sports injury prevention techniques, the importance of rest, and the negative effects of drugs on athletic performance.</p> Thu, 06 May 2010 00:00:00 -0500 http://fitnesstogether.com/ashland/blog/900/Sports-Conditioning-for-Teens
